How to Install Putco Stainless Steel Door Sills - F150 Logo on your F-150

Installation Time

20 minutes

Tools Required
  • Rubbing Alcohol
  • Clean Towel

Door Sill Installation

1. Clean and dry the vehicle thoroughly.


2. The vehicle surface temperature must be a minimum of 10°C (50°F).


3. Apply rubbing alcohol to the clean towel and wipe down the entire boxed area shown in Figure 1 on the door. This will ensure proper adhesion to the vehicle. (Passenger side shown)


4. As shown in Figure 2, remove the red 3M backing from the front door sill


5. Align the door sill with the edge of the plastic step pad. IMPORTANT: Do not to allow the adhesive surface of the door sill to touch the vehicle prior to being in the correct location. To align, lower part into position at a 45° angle matching the radius of the door sill with the radius of the vehicle. See Figure 3. 


6. Press door sill to the vehicle matching the radius of the door sill with the radius of the vehicle. Hold in position for 30 seconds to ensure proper adhesion. Remove protective film. See Figure 4 for proper alignment. 


7. Repeat steps 3 - 5 for each door.
